Let the perimeter of the square and circumference of the circle be ‘7x’ cm and ‘11x’ cm, respectively. Area of square = a2 (Where ‘a’ is the side of the square) ATQ; 49 = a2 Or, a = 7 cm So, perimeter of the square = 7 × 4 = 28 cm So, circumference of circle = 28 × (11x/7x) = 44 cm Circumference of circle = 2πr (Where ‘r’ is the radius) So, 44 = 2 × (22/7) × r Or, r = 7 cm Therefore, radius of the circle is 7 cm.
